The Panduit PR2VSD0896 delivers ultra-high-density cable management in space-constrained datacenters and network closets. This 52 RU dual-sided vertical manager uses an 8-inch footprint to route hundreds of patch cords without consuming additional floor space, freeing up valuable rack positions for active equipment. The fully pre-assembled construction eliminates field assembly time—mount the unit, load cables, and close the hinged door. For integrators managing 10G/25G/40G leaf-spine fabrics or high-port-count access switches, this manager maintains service loops and separation while keeping both sides of the rack accessible.
The PR2VSD0896 architecture combines a structural steel backbone with injection-molded plastic fingers to balance rigidity and flexibility. The central spine mounts to standard rack rails via cage nuts or threaded holes, carrying the load of fully populated cable bundles without deflection. Fingers are spaced at 1 RU intervals and form a D-ring profile—cables route behind the fingers, held in place by the natural spring tension of the plastic. This eliminates the need for Velcro straps or tie-wraps during adds/moves/changes; pull a cable forward past the finger to remove it, press it back to secure it. The dual-sided architecture presents fingers on both the front and rear faces, allowing independent routing for two separate cable planes. In a typical leaf-spine deployment, front fingers manage northbound links to aggregation switches while rear fingers handle southbound server or storage connections. Each side operates independently—no shared channels or cross-routing.
The full-length metal door spans all 52 RU and hinges from either the left or right edge depending on aisle access requirements. Push-to-close latching engages automatically when the door contacts the frame; no separate latch handle to operate during hurried maintenance windows. The dual-hinging mechanism allows the door to swing 180 degrees in either direction, so a left-hinged door can still open fully even when adjacent racks limit clearance on one side. Door removal is tool-free via hinge pins—lift the door off during initial cable loading, then reinstall once the bulk of patch cords are dressed. The perforated metal construction maintains airflow and allows visual inspection of cable fill without opening the door. For installations requiring complete concealment (secure facilities, client-facing NOCs), the solid door panel prevents line-of-sight identification of specific connections.
Deploy the PR2VSD0896 in datacenter row builds where every RU counts toward compute or switching density. A single manager supports 200+ Cat 6A patch cords or 400+ LC duplex fiber jumpers depending on bundling and service-loop requirements. For Cisco Nexus 9300-series or Arista 7000-series top-of-rack switches with 48–96 ports, mount one manager per rack to handle all access-layer patching without blocking exhaust airflow or obstructing cable arms on adjacent equipment. In network refresh projects replacing 1G copper with 10G/25G fiber, the 8-inch depth accommodates the larger bend radius and duplex LC connector bodies without forcing cables into sharp turns. Install managers on both sides of a two-post relay rack for bidirectional cable routing in cross-connect applications, or use a single manager on one side of a four-post cabinet to keep the opposite side clear for equipment with rear-access service doors.
The pre-assembled design reduces installation labor by 60–75 percent compared to field-assembled finger duct systems. A two-person crew can mount, level, and secure the PR2VSD0896 in under 15 minutes using standard rack-mounting hardware. The unit ships with mounting brackets and cage nuts included; no separate accessory kit required. UL 2416 and CSA C22.2 certification ensures compliance with NFPA 70 (NEC) Article 800 and Canadian Electrical Code Part I for low-voltage cabling systems in occupied buildings—critical for inspected installations in hospitals, schools, government facilities, and multi-tenant datacenters. RoHS compliance satisfies EU procurement requirements for large-scale international deployments. The PatchRunner 2 family integrates with Panduit's structured cabling ecosystem including Pre-Term fiber trunks, copper patch panels, and horizontal cable management—specify matching components for a complete validated system with unified warranty and support.
